Kinds Of Paint Finishes



When it comes to paint finishes, there are 5 main kinds you need to understand about: flat,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each type offers a details purpose and can dramatically impact the look of your space.

Level finishes have a matte look, making them wonderful for concealing blemishes on wall surfaces. They're best for ceilings or low-traffic locations but can be challenging to clean.

Eggshell finishes provide a minor luster, giving more sturdiness while still being forgiving on imperfections. They're excellent for living spaces or rooms.

Satin finishes are popular for their soft sheen, making them functional for different applications, including bathroom and kitchens. They're easier to tidy than flat or eggshell surfaces, making them useful for high-traffic locations.

Semi-gloss surfaces give a visible sparkle, which works well for trim, moldings, and cupboards. They're very sturdy and simple to clean down, excellent for spaces vulnerable to wetness.

Ultimately, gloss finishes have a reflective, glossy surface, making them ideal for accent pieces or furniture.

Recognizing these types of paint coatings will aid you make informed decisions for your next painting task.

Choosing the Right Finish



Choosing the best paint surface can be a game changer in your house's visual and performance. To make the best selection, think about the room's purpose and the degree of sturdiness you require.

For high-traffic locations like hallways or kitchen areas, go with a satin or semi-gloss finish; these are much more resistant to stains and simple to tidy.

If you're painting a bedroom or a living room, a flat or eggshell coating might be the way to go. These surfaces provide a softer appearance and can hide flaws well, developing a comfy ambience.

Do not forget about lighting, either. Shiny coatings can show light, making a tiny area really feel bigger, while matte coatings soak up light, adding warmth.
